…It is an offshoot of Irish, but the initial state of the language is unclear. The first Manx document was a translation of The Book of Common Prayer (c. 1610), and most of the extant manuscripts written in the 18th and 19th centuries are religious. In this language, not only has initial nasalization been achieved, but the phonetic function of palatals has also been partially lost. … *Some of the terminology that refers to "The Book of Common Prayer" is listed below.
